Abstract EN

Intellectual deviation leads to dangerous consequences.

It provokes some youth in Kingdom of Saudi Arabia (KSA) to threat social security and stability by committing terrorist operations.

These operations may be explosions, killing innocents, or devastating public property.

Therefore, the ministry of education has adopted the National Protective Program for providing male and female students with psychological protection against the dangerous behaviors and deviant ideas.

This program was named “FATEN” (The minister of education decree No.

261128506 dated on 9/6/1436).

By reviewing the previous studies, we find that they have focused on the roles of teacher, curriculum, and activities in dealing with intellectual deviation problem.

however, there is an important player who is responsible for activating such roles; the school manager.

The school manager is the main factor for successful protection programs against intellectual deviation.

By taking all these factors into consideration, we can say that maintaining intellectual security is a social responsibility on all school employees.

If the school reduces the intellectual deviation impacts, this will be one of the most important components or effective strategies for treating this problem in a world threated by intellectual and security disorders.

The study is limited to governmental and national secondary schools in Riyadh.

It highlights the viewpoints of the study sample that includes managers and students guides, and concentrates on the school role in protecting students against intellectual deviation.

Moreover, the study terminology have been presented in a procedural form by giving a procedural definition for intellectual deviation as: A deviant thought that makes its believer abandon the prevailing social and religious customs and traditions; especially by adopting a misleading understanding of religion.

Accordingly, exaggeration, extremism, or takfirism may be disastrous consequences for this intellectual deviation.

The study sample individuals have shown their responses to a questionnaire prepared by the researcher about deviant intellectual consequences on students of governmental and national secondary schools in Riyadh.

In addition, the study is based on some theories for interpreting the study subject.

The most important ones are: social alienation theory by Durkheim, differential association theory, and functionalism theory.

The study is based on the analytical descriptive approach, and its questionnaire is distributed to (224) educational guides and (143) managers.

The study presents some findings.

It indicates that intellectual deviation has dangerous consequences.

According to the viewpoint of the school managers, the student suffering from intellectual deviation considers the community members unbelievers.

On the other side, intellectual deviation makes the student indignant at his local community in particular, and at the whole community in general, according to the viewpoint of the student guides.

The school managers see that there are some factors leading to intellectual deviation.

They think that the weak educational role of secondary schools in dealing with intellectual deviation and its aggravating impacts is a basic factor for intellectual deviation.

However, the student guides agree that poor scientific and practical knowledge of the school manager when dealing with intellectual deviation problem is the main reason for such problem escalation.

The responses of school managers demonstrate that motivating family for guiding their children, through cooperation programs between family and school, to avoid watching any content including an intellectual deviation is a positive step toward student protection.

However, the student guides responses show that Islamic education approaches and their comprehensiveness is vital for such protection.

The study offers some recommendations.

The most important ones are as follow: ■ Intellectual deviation forms in schools should be monitored and treated at an early stage.

Subsequently, practical mechanisms for reducing this kind of deviation can be identified.

Such mechanisms may include scientific symposiums, activities, curricula, and competitions.

■ The school should be a secure environment that supports intellectual security and resists any intellectual deviation.

This can be realized by activating the educational role of secondary schools in treating intellectual deviation and its dangerous impacts.

■ Students should become aware of the best way for using social media.

This goal can be achieved by holding seminars and teaching academic courses on the best usage of social media which are considered a direct tool for intellectual deviation.
